SAN DIEGO, Oct. 1,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Robbins LLP reminds stockholders that a class action was filed on behalf of persons and entities that purchased or otherwise acquired C3.ai, Inc. (NYSE: AI) securities between February 26, 2025 and August 8, 2025. C3.ai is a global artificial intelligence application software company.

The Allegations: Robbins LLP is Investigating Allegations that C3.ai, Inc. (AI) Misled Investors Regarding the Impact of its CEO's Health on its Business Prospects

According to the complaint, during the class period, defendants failed to disclose the impact the Chief Executive Officer's health was having on the Company's ability to close deals, that its management was unable or otherwise ineffectual in minimizing that impact, and that C3.ai would not be able to execute upon its profit and potential growth as a result. 

Plaintiff alleges that on August 8, 2025, C3 AI announced disappointing preliminary financial results for the first quarter of fiscal 2026 and reduced its revenue guidance for the full fiscal year 2026. The Company attributed its poor sales results and lowered guidance on "the reorganization with new leadership" and the health ailments of its Chief Executive Officer.  On this news, the price of C3.ai common stock fell from $22.13 per share on August 8, 2025, to $16.47 per share on August 11, 2025, a decline of over 25%.
